What is the Ibanez AGB200? What kind of bass guitar is it?
The Ibanez AGB200 is a semi-hollow body electric bass guitar from the Artcore Bass series. It blends the warm, resonant tone of a hollow body instrument with modern electric bass playability. It's well-suited for jazz, blues, R&B, funk, indie rock, and lighter rock genres.

What are the key features and specifications of the Ibanez AGB200?

  • Body: Semi-hollow or full-hollow (with sustain block on most models)
  • Material: Maple top, back, and sides
  • Neck: 3-piece Nyatoh/Maple set-in
  • Fretboard: Bound Laurel or Rosewood with dot inlays
  • Scale: 30.3" short scale
  • Frets: 22 medium
  • Pickups: 2 x Classic Elite Bass Humbuckers (passive)
  • Bridge: Gibraltar III Bass Bridge with Quik Change III tailpiece
  • Controls: Neck and bridge volume, master tone
  • Hardware: Chrome
  • Finish options: Transparent Red, Dark Violin Sunburst (varies by year)

What are the advantages of a short-scale bass like the AGB200?

  • Easier to play, especially for smaller hands or guitarists switching to bass
  • Produces a warm, punchy tone with low string tension
  • Unique feel and tactile response
  • Slightly more compact and portable than standard long-scale basses

How do the Classic Elite Bass Humbucking pickups sound?

  • Warm and clear, enhancing the natural tone of the semi-hollow body
  • Humbucking design minimizes hum and noise
  • Well-balanced output suitable for jazz, blues, and light rock
  • Versatile enough for both mellow and punchy bass tones

What is a semi-hollow body bass, and how does it affect the tone?

  • A semi-hollow body has a solid center block with hollow wings
  • Adds acoustic-like resonance and warmth to the tone
  • Reduces feedback compared to a full-hollow body
  • Creates a soft attack and round, woody tone that decays quickly

Is the AGB200 prone to feedback issues in live settings?
Not significantly. The center sustain block reduces unwanted feedback. At high stage volumes, feedback is still possible but manageable with careful amp placement and EQ adjustments.

What kind of strings are best for the AGB200?
Many players prefer flatwound strings to emphasize warmth and vintage-style thump. Use short-scale specific strings for proper fit and tension.

Is the AGB200 a good choice for a beginner bass player?
Yes. Its short scale, comfortable body, and warm, forgiving tone make it ideal for new players. It’s also well-built and versatile enough to grow with a beginner’s skill level.

What type of music is the Ibanez AGB200 semi-hollow bass best suited for?

The Ibanez AGB200 semi-hollow bass is well-suited for jazz, blues, and rock genres due to its warm, resonant tones provided by the semi-hollow body and Classic Elite Bass humbuckers.

How does the Ibanez AGB200's short scale length affect playability?

The 30.3" short scale length of the Ibanez AGB200 offers easier playability, especially for players with smaller hands, and provides a slightly warmer tone compared to standard scale basses.

What are the tonal characteristics of the Ibanez Classic Elite Bass humbuckers?

The Ibanez Classic Elite Bass humbuckers deliver a warm, full-bodied sound with a smooth low-end response, making them ideal for versatile playing styles.

Is the Ibanez AGB200 suitable for beginner bass players?

Yes, the Ibanez AGB200 is suitable for beginners due to its comfortable Artcore neck profile and manageable short scale length, which make it easier to play.

Does the Ibanez AGB200 come with a case or gig bag?

No, the Ibanez AGB200 does not come with a case or gig bag; these must be purchased separately.
